[1/3] hw/intc/arm_gicv3: Add cast to match the documentation

The result of 1 << regbit with regbit==31 has a 1 in the 32nd bit.
When cast to uint64_t (for further bitwise OR), the 32 most
significant bits will be filled with 1s. However, the documentation
states that the upper 32 bits of ICH_AP[0/1]R<n>_EL2 are reserved.

Add an explicit cast to match the documentation.

Found by Linux Verification Center (linuxtesting.org) with SVACE.

Fixes: d2c0c6aab6 ("hw/intc/arm_gicv3: Handle icv_nmiar1_read() for icc_nmiar1_read()")

diff --git a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_cpuif.c b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_cpuif.c
index bdb13b00e9..ebad7aaea1 100644
--- a/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_cpuif.c
+++ b/hw/intc/arm_gicv3_cpuif.c
@@ -781,7 +781,7 @@  static void icv_activate_irq(GICv3CPUState *cs, int idx, int grp)
     if (nmi) {
         cs->ich_apr[grp][regno] |= ICV_AP1R_EL1_NMI;
     } else {
-        cs->ich_apr[grp][regno] |= (1 << regbit);
+        cs->ich_apr[grp][regno] |= (1U << regbit);
     }
 }
